Convertor / Adaptor for Japan and S. Korea

What do I need as far as convertor / adaptor for Japan?

I only have my ipad and Android smart phone. And maybe a massage gun. I will be spending three nights in Yokohama before sailing.

We are going to overnight in S. Korea but I will be sleeping on the ship so I do not think I will need anything but what the ship provides.

Assuming you're American, Japan uses the same plug type (two flat prongs) and should fit your phone and iPad plugs. You won't need a voltage adapter for phone or iPad, not sure about massage gun. South Korea uses a European plug (two round pins).

I charged all my electronics without any converter. The only time you would need an adapter would be for something that involves the third (grounding) prong (perhaps a CPAP machine) and that would allow you to change three prong to two prong.

Let's make this nice and simple.

For Japan, it will be just like home. Same plug, same voltage. You don't need anything.

For South Korea, it's basically the same as what you had for Portugal or much of western Europe. Whatever you did there do that in South Korea.
